Reduce allocation overhead in quantized sdpa #15610

For small models dequantizing portions of v cache causes extra alloc overhead. Probably a better way to handle this is to dequantize entire v cache outside the model There isnt significant perf advantage from this yet but subsequent diffs will use caching allocator where this refactor help.
